Capacity note: clock skew across the Fernpool build agents.

Our artifact timestamps and cache-validity checks assume agents agree on time within a tight bound. Skew beyond that bound causes spurious cache invalidation, which roughly doubles build load during peak hours. Agents sync against two internal time sources; if both drift, the scheduler quarantines the agent. Please treat these bounds as contractual when provisioning new agents. The enforced constants follow.

tuning constants:
QUOTAS = {
    "druwyn": 5,
    "holix": 5,
    "zorath": 5,
    "holwyn": 10,
}

## Brokerhawk Upgrade: Environment Variables

Scope: migrating the Lanternmill message broker from v3 to v4. Most variables carry over unchanged; review the diff in the upgrade branch. One security-relevant change: v4 drops plaintext inter-node auth and requires a cluster secret in the environment of every node. Verify rotation policy covers it and that it never appears in logs. Each node's env file must include the following line.

vault entry, kafog-yahop: COURIER_KEY8=0faa53ae

## Idempotency Keys for Payment Retries (Lumopay)

Every retry of a charge request must reuse the original idempotency key; generating a new key on retry can produce duplicate charges. Keys are scoped per merchant and expire after 48 hours. Reviewers should verify keys are derived server-side, never from client input. The full key-generation specification and threat model are maintained on the internal page.

dashboard of kaguf-tawip = https://vault.merlaqsys.test/issue